Skip to content

Commit 109ca3c

Browse files
committed
Update mainline NGINX to 1.23.0
* Update NJS to 0.7.5 * Update mainline Alpine Linux to 3.16
1 parent c2e8e98 commit 109ca3c

File tree

9 files changed

+42
-42
lines changed

9 files changed

+42
-42
lines changed

mainline/alpine-perl/Dockerfile

Lines changed: 8 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-3,13 +3,13 @@
33
#
44
# PLEASE DO NOT EDIT IT DIRECTLY.
55
#
6-
ARG IMAGE=alpine:3.15
6+
ARG IMAGE=alpine:3.16
77
FROM $IMAGE
88

99
LABEL maintainer="NGINX Docker Maintainers <[email protected]>"
1010

11-
ENV NGINX_VERSION 1.21.6
12-
ENV NJS_VERSION 0.7.3
11+
ENV NGINX_VERSION 1.23.0
12+
ENV NJS_VERSION 0.7.5
1313
ENV PKG_RELEASE 1
1414

1515
ARG UID=101
@@ -71,16 +71,16 @@ RUN set -x \
7171
&& su nobody -s /bin/sh -c " \
7272
export HOME=${tempDir} \
7373
&& cd ${tempDir} \
74-
&& curl -f -O https://hg.nginx.org/pkg-oss/archive/688.tar.gz \
75-
&& PKGOSSCHECKSUM=\"a8ab6ff80ab67c6c9567a9103b52a42a5962e9c1bc7091b7710aaf553a3b484af61b0797dd9b048c518e371a6f69e34d474cfaaeaa116fd2824bffa1cd9d4718 *688.tar.gz\" \
76-
&& if [ \"\$(openssl sha512 -r 688.tar.gz)\" = \"\$PKGOSSCHECKSUM\" ]; then \
74+
&& curl -f -O https://hg.nginx.org/pkg-oss/archive/${NGINX_VERSION}-${PKG_RELEASE}.tar.gz \
75+
&& PKGOSSCHECKSUM=\"678b1e9ab34777f1a1a1a8717aff0dfa08cc187cf2cf140c084d23205f3ba3af97805e72ebbed49dd7bfcb23bbeca982b150fff5c2a6c96f161ed9085101f1a4 *${NGINX_VERSION}-${PKG_RELEASE}.tar.gz\" \
76+
&& if [ \"\$(openssl sha512 -r ${NGINX_VERSION}-${PKG_RELEASE}.tar.gz)\" = \"\$PKGOSSCHECKSUM\" ]; then \
7777
echo \"pkg-oss tarball checksum verification succeeded!\"; \
7878
else \
7979
echo \"pkg-oss tarball checksum verification failed!\"; \
8080
exit 1; \
8181
fi \
82-
&& tar xzvf 688.tar.gz \
83-
&& cd pkg-oss-688 \
82+
&& tar xzvf ${NGINX_VERSION}-${PKG_RELEASE}.tar.gz \
83+
&& cd pkg-oss-${NGINX_VERSION}-${PKG_RELEASE} \
8484
&& cd alpine \
8585
&& make all \
8686
&& apk index -o ${tempDir}/packages/alpine/${apkArch}/APKINDEX.tar.gz ${tempDir}/packages/alpine/${apkArch}/*.apk \

mainline/alpine/Dockerfile

Lines changed: 8 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-3,13 +3,13 @@
33
#
44
# PLEASE DO NOT EDIT IT DIRECTLY.
55
#
6-
ARG IMAGE=alpine:3.15
6+
ARG IMAGE=alpine:3.16
77
FROM $IMAGE
88

99
LABEL maintainer="NGINX Docker Maintainers <[email protected]>"
1010

11-
ENV NGINX_VERSION 1.21.6
12-
ENV NJS_VERSION 0.7.3
11+
ENV NGINX_VERSION 1.23.0
12+
ENV NJS_VERSION 0.7.5
1313
ENV PKG_RELEASE 1
1414

1515
ARG UID=101
@@ -70,16 +70,16 @@ RUN set -x \
7070
&& su nobody -s /bin/sh -c " \
7171
export HOME=${tempDir} \
7272
&& cd ${tempDir} \
73-
&& curl -f -O https://hg.nginx.org/pkg-oss/archive/688.tar.gz \
74-
&& PKGOSSCHECKSUM=\"a8ab6ff80ab67c6c9567a9103b52a42a5962e9c1bc7091b7710aaf553a3b484af61b0797dd9b048c518e371a6f69e34d474cfaaeaa116fd2824bffa1cd9d4718 *688.tar.gz\" \
75-
&& if [ \"\$(openssl sha512 -r 688.tar.gz)\" = \"\$PKGOSSCHECKSUM\" ]; then \
73+
&& curl -f -O https://hg.nginx.org/pkg-oss/archive/${NGINX_VERSION}-${PKG_RELEASE}.tar.gz \
74+
&& PKGOSSCHECKSUM=\"678b1e9ab34777f1a1a1a8717aff0dfa08cc187cf2cf140c084d23205f3ba3af97805e72ebbed49dd7bfcb23bbeca982b150fff5c2a6c96f161ed9085101f1a4 *${NGINX_VERSION}-${PKG_RELEASE}.tar.gz\" \
75+
&& if [ \"\$(openssl sha512 -r ${NGINX_VERSION}-${PKG_RELEASE}.tar.gz)\" = \"\$PKGOSSCHECKSUM\" ]; then \
7676
echo \"pkg-oss tarball checksum verification succeeded!\"; \
7777
else \
7878
echo \"pkg-oss tarball checksum verification failed!\"; \
7979
exit 1; \
8080
fi \
81-
&& tar xzvf 688.tar.gz \
82-
&& cd pkg-oss-688 \
81+
&& tar xzvf ${NGINX_VERSION}-${PKG_RELEASE}.tar.gz \
82+
&& cd pkg-oss-${NGINX_VERSION}-${PKG_RELEASE} \
8383
&& cd alpine \
8484
&& make all \
8585
&& apk index -o ${tempDir}/packages/alpine/${apkArch}/APKINDEX.tar.gz ${tempDir}/packages/alpine/${apkArch}/*.apk \

mainline/debian-perl/Dockerfile

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-8,8 +8,8 @@ FROM $IMAGE
88

99
LABEL maintainer="NGINX Docker Maintainers <[email protected]>"
1010

11-
ENV NGINX_VERSION 1.21.6
12-
ENV NJS_VERSION 0.7.3
11+
ENV NGINX_VERSION 1.23.0
12+
ENV NJS_VERSION 0.7.5
1313
ENV PKG_RELEASE 1~bullseye
1414

1515
ARG UID=101

mainline/debian/Dockerfile

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-8,8 +8,8 @@ FROM $IMAGE
88

99
LABEL maintainer="NGINX Docker Maintainers <[email protected]>"
1010

11-
ENV NGINX_VERSION 1.21.6
12-
ENV NJS_VERSION 0.7.3
11+
ENV NGINX_VERSION 1.23.0
12+
ENV NJS_VERSION 0.7.5
1313
ENV PKG_RELEASE 1~bullseye
1414

1515
ARG UID=101

stable/alpine-perl/Dockerfile

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-9,7 +9,7 @@ FROM $IMAGE
99
LABEL maintainer="NGINX Docker Maintainers <[email protected]>"
1010

1111
ENV NGINX_VERSION 1.22.0
12-
ENV NJS_VERSION 0.7.4
12+
ENV NJS_VERSION 0.7.5
1313
ENV PKG_RELEASE 1
1414

1515
ARG UID=101
@@ -71,16 +71,16 @@ RUN set -x \
7171
&& su nobody -s /bin/sh -c " \
7272
export HOME=${tempDir} \
7373
&& cd ${tempDir} \
74-
&& curl -f -O https://hg.nginx.org/pkg-oss/archive/696.tar.gz \
75-
&& PKGOSSCHECKSUM=\"fabf394af60d935d7c3f5e36db65dddcced9595fd06d3dfdfabbb77aaea88a5b772ef9c1521531673bdbb2876390cdea3b81c51030d36ab76cf5bfc0bfe79230 *696.tar.gz\" \
76-
&& if [ \"\$(openssl sha512 -r 696.tar.gz)\" = \"\$PKGOSSCHECKSUM\" ]; then \
74+
&& curl -f -O https://hg.nginx.org/pkg-oss/archive/714.tar.gz \
75+
&& PKGOSSCHECKSUM=\"f457d5988c1f2663e04c5cdad71874c25e94754277dd9da5d73c1d37c32bdaf288b3b20d8b5d070ffb33aab363eaf4a7abbcf95fcfd72b0729a1c1908c37e30e *714.tar.gz\" \
76+
&& if [ \"\$(openssl sha512 -r 714.tar.gz)\" = \"\$PKGOSSCHECKSUM\" ]; then \
7777
echo \"pkg-oss tarball checksum verification succeeded!\"; \
7878
else \
7979
echo \"pkg-oss tarball checksum verification failed!\"; \
8080
exit 1; \
8181
fi \
82-
&& tar xzvf 696.tar.gz \
83-
&& cd pkg-oss-696 \
82+
&& tar xzvf 714.tar.gz \
83+
&& cd pkg-oss-714 \
8484
&& cd alpine \
8585
&& make all \
8686
&& apk index -o ${tempDir}/packages/alpine/${apkArch}/APKINDEX.tar.gz ${tempDir}/packages/alpine/${apkArch}/*.apk \

stable/alpine/Dockerfile

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-9,7 +9,7 @@ FROM $IMAGE
99
LABEL maintainer="NGINX Docker Maintainers <[email protected]>"
1010

1111
ENV NGINX_VERSION 1.22.0
12-
ENV NJS_VERSION 0.7.4
12+
ENV NJS_VERSION 0.7.5
1313
ENV PKG_RELEASE 1
1414

1515
ARG UID=101
@@ -70,16 +70,16 @@ RUN set -x \
7070
&& su nobody -s /bin/sh -c " \
7171
export HOME=${tempDir} \
7272
&& cd ${tempDir} \
73-
&& curl -f -O https://hg.nginx.org/pkg-oss/archive/696.tar.gz \
74-
&& PKGOSSCHECKSUM=\"fabf394af60d935d7c3f5e36db65dddcced9595fd06d3dfdfabbb77aaea88a5b772ef9c1521531673bdbb2876390cdea3b81c51030d36ab76cf5bfc0bfe79230 *696.tar.gz\" \
75-
&& if [ \"\$(openssl sha512 -r 696.tar.gz)\" = \"\$PKGOSSCHECKSUM\" ]; then \
73+
&& curl -f -O https://hg.nginx.org/pkg-oss/archive/714.tar.gz \
74+
&& PKGOSSCHECKSUM=\"f457d5988c1f2663e04c5cdad71874c25e94754277dd9da5d73c1d37c32bdaf288b3b20d8b5d070ffb33aab363eaf4a7abbcf95fcfd72b0729a1c1908c37e30e *714.tar.gz\" \
75+
&& if [ \"\$(openssl sha512 -r 714.tar.gz)\" = \"\$PKGOSSCHECKSUM\" ]; then \
7676
echo \"pkg-oss tarball checksum verification succeeded!\"; \
7777
else \
7878
echo \"pkg-oss tarball checksum verification failed!\"; \
7979
exit 1; \
8080
fi \
81-
&& tar xzvf 696.tar.gz \
82-
&& cd pkg-oss-696 \
81+
&& tar xzvf 714.tar.gz \
82+
&& cd pkg-oss-714 \
8383
&& cd alpine \
8484
&& make all \
8585
&& apk index -o ${tempDir}/packages/alpine/${apkArch}/APKINDEX.tar.gz ${tempDir}/packages/alpine/${apkArch}/*.apk \

stable/debian-perl/Dockerfile

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-9,7 +9,7 @@ FROM $IMAGE
99
LABEL maintainer="NGINX Docker Maintainers <[email protected]>"
1010

1111
ENV NGINX_VERSION 1.22.0
12-
ENV NJS_VERSION 0.7.4
12+
ENV NJS_VERSION 0.7.5
1313
ENV PKG_RELEASE 1~bullseye
1414

1515
ARG UID=101

stable/debian/Dockerfile

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-9,7 +9,7 @@ FROM $IMAGE
99
LABEL maintainer="NGINX Docker Maintainers <[email protected]>"
1010

1111
ENV NGINX_VERSION 1.22.0
12-
ENV NJS_VERSION 0.7.4
12+
ENV NJS_VERSION 0.7.5
1313
ENV PKG_RELEASE 1~bullseye
1414

1515
ARG UID=101

update.sh

Lines changed: 8 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-12,14 +12,14 @@ declare branches=(
1212
# Current nginx versions
1313
# Remember to update pkgosschecksum when changing this.
1414
declare -A nginx=(
15-
[mainline]='1.21.6'
15+
[mainline]='1.23.0'
1616
[stable]='1.22.0'
1717
)
1818

1919
# Current njs versions
2020
declare -A njs=(
21-
[mainline]='0.7.3'
22-
[stable]='0.7.4'
21+
[mainline]='0.7.5'
22+
[stable]='0.7.5'
2323
)
2424

2525
# Current package patchlevel version
@@ -35,7 +35,7 @@ declare -A debian=(
3535
)
3636

3737
declare -A alpine=(
38-
[mainline]='3.15'
38+
[mainline]='3.16'
3939
[stable]='3.16'
4040
)
4141

@@ -44,16 +44,16 @@ declare -A alpine=(
4444
# when building alpine packages on architectures not supported by nginx.org
4545
# Remember to update pkgosschecksum when changing this.
4646
declare -A rev=(
47-
[mainline]='688'
48-
[stable]='696'
47+
[mainline]='${NGINX_VERSION}-${PKG_RELEASE}'
48+
[stable]='714'
4949
)
5050

5151
# Holds SHA512 checksum for the pkg-oss tarball produced by source code
5252
# revision/tag in the previous block
5353
# Used in alpine builds for architectures not packaged by nginx.org
5454
declare -A pkgosschecksum=(
55-
[mainline]='a8ab6ff80ab67c6c9567a9103b52a42a5962e9c1bc7091b7710aaf553a3b484af61b0797dd9b048c518e371a6f69e34d474cfaaeaa116fd2824bffa1cd9d4718'
56-
[stable]='fabf394af60d935d7c3f5e36db65dddcced9595fd06d3dfdfabbb77aaea88a5b772ef9c1521531673bdbb2876390cdea3b81c51030d36ab76cf5bfc0bfe79230'
55+
[mainline]='678b1e9ab34777f1a1a1a8717aff0dfa08cc187cf2cf140c084d23205f3ba3af97805e72ebbed49dd7bfcb23bbeca982b150fff5c2a6c96f161ed9085101f1a4'
56+
[stable]='f457d5988c1f2663e04c5cdad71874c25e94754277dd9da5d73c1d37c32bdaf288b3b20d8b5d070ffb33aab363eaf4a7abbcf95fcfd72b0729a1c1908c37e30e'
5757
)
5858

5959
get_packages() {

0 commit comments

Comments
 (0)